W208 track car build
Mods:
Kleeman headers
Metal cats
Renntech airbox
BMC air filter
Eurocharged ecu and TCU
3.06 rear ratio
Quiafe diff
Kmac bushings
kW v2
Recaro pole position
Bluetop solenoids
M3 gts wing
Oz wheels
Paddle shifter conversion
Evosport ignition wires and phenolic spacers
Quad exhaust conversion
True transmission manual mode
Carlsson front bumper
Michelin pss
Ap racing brakes (6 pot front & 4 pot rear)
Miltex f3r brake pads
Amg diff cooler fins
Mogul 600 brake fluid
Ifr6d10 spark plugs
Future mods:
Sunroof delete
Roll bar/half cage
Cf driveshaft
Evosport UD pulley
unfortunately lot of these required custom work and research, feel free to reach out if you have any question.

3.06 gears are from c32 diff, you just need to get tcu tune for that.
Regarding manual mode, that's from tcu tune euro charged did for c32 guys. I got it done same time as gear change. Just sent my tcu back as I'm having some issues but they should be able to fix it. You just need to make sure you have egs52 tcu.
On seats, those are recaro pole positions. They are pretty much used on all special edition amg, except for clk dtm. bracket needed some research, blackbenz has same setup and helped with finding right parts.

If you need more power, look for a crank pulley. When i had it on my w208 (320) it dyno'd an additional 11whp. I had the EvoSport UD pulley kit too. but with the crank pulley on my w208, you can feel the pull throughout the entire power band. Not bad for a V6.
